Whistling Spider Butterfly displayed in a compact 6"x6"Anton Ausserer first described the genus Selenocosmia in 1871, and it is found in China, New Guinea, and Australia. These tarantulas are distinguished by their use of lyra hairs to produce a distinct stridulation, earning them the names "whistling" or "barking" spiders.
